§ 9-11-2 — Acquisition of Lands for State Game Lands; Erection, Etc., of Buildings for Propagation of Game, Birds or Fish
Alabama·Title 9 Conservation and Natural Resources·Ch. 11 Fish, Game and Wildlife·Art. 1 General Provisions
The Commissioner of Conservation and Natural Resources may with the consent and approval of the Governor by lease, gift or otherwise acquire title to or control over lands within the state suitable for protection and propagation of game and fish or for public hunting and fishing purposes or to be used otherwise as provided in this chapter, to be known as state game lands. The director may purchase, erect and equip such buildings as may be deemed necessary for propagating game, birds or fish; provided, however, that all purchases made under the powers conferred in this section shall be subject to the provisions of Chapters 4 and 5 of Title 41.

Legislative History
(Acts 1935, No. 240, p. 632, §24; Code 1940, T. 8, §25.)
